What happens if a helmet is too tight?

Explanation:
Fit is what this question checks. When a helmet is too tight, it presses on the scalp and temples, creating pressure points that can cause sores and headaches. That discomfort can make you want to loosen or remove the helmet, which undermines safety. The right fit is snug but comfortable—level on the head with the chin strap secure but not painfully tight. In that state, it stays in place and provides protection without causing painful pressure.
